rdiff-backup: сколько ресурсов на удаление файлов?
У меня есть очень маленькая NAS для моей домашней сети, которая представляет собой плату RaspberryPI 2B с внешним 2,5-дюймовым жестким диском емкостью 5 ТБ и вторым внешним жестким диском емкостью 8 ТБ 3,5 дюйма в качестве резервной копии для первого жесткого диска.
Внешние накопители имеют интерфейс USB-3.1, но RaspberryPI 2B ограничен USB-2.0.
Каждую ночь cron запускает команду rdiff-backup для резервного копирования первого жесткого диска на второй с помощью следующей команды:
rdiff-backup -v5 --print-statistics /mnt/path/to/first/hd /mnt/path/to/second/hd > /mnt/path/to/logfile.txt 2>&1
Объем данных составляет около 2,4 ТБ, и данные не меняются слишком сильно и/или слишком часто, поэтому обычно для завершения требуется менее одного часа.
Я удалил около 190 ГБ данных, и последующее ночное резервное копирование rdiff заняло около 20 часов, как видно из следующей «статистики сеанса»:
--------------[ Session statistics ]--------------
StartTime 1674947473.00 (Sun Jan 29 00:11:13 2023)
EndTime 1675019345.20 (Sun Jan 29 20:09:05 2023)
ElapsedTime 71872.20 (19 hours 57 minutes 52.20 seconds)
SourceFiles 587966
SourceFileSize 2478059464427 (2.25 TB)
MirrorFiles 648095
MirrorFileSize 2680696698787 (2.44 TB)
NewFiles 244
NewFileSize 56148049 (53.5 MB)
DeletedFiles 60373
DeletedFileSize 202693429576 (189 GB)
ChangedFiles 528
ChangedSourceSize 64164508 (61.2 MB)
ChangedMirrorSize 64117341 (61.1 MB)
IncrementFiles 61151
IncrementFileSize 197243485656 (184 GB)
TotalDestinationSizeChange -5393748704 (-5.02 GB)
Errors 0
Это нормально все это время удалять файлы?
Возможно, это связано с низкой производительностью маленькой (и старой) платы RaspberryPI 2B и ее USB-2.0??
Можно ли улучшить производительность этой системы, используя «мини-ПК» (например, Intel NUC) вместо RaspberryPI 2B???
Заранее спасибо за вашу помощь.